[TYPO3-dev] stable = documented ?

Stefan Geith typo3dev2006 at geithware.de
Tue Jul 25 09:37:27 CEST 2006


Elmar Hinz wrote:
> R. van Twisk wrote:
>> ...
> ...
> for me the existance of ext_typoscript_setup.txt and
> ext_typoscript_constants.txt are alarm bells for an outdated extensions.
> Modern extensions shouldn't contain TS templates that can't be deselected.

WHY shouldn't Extensions contain TS templates ?
I think mostly every extension needs some _minimum_ TS
configuration; and I think the place for this
would be ext_typoscript_setup.txt - Am I wrong ?


> I want to see:
> 
> pi1/static/setup.txt
> pi1/static/constants.txt
> 
> or
> 
> static/pi1/setup.txt
> static/pi1/constants.txt
> 
> I like best
> 
> configuration/pluginXY/setup.txt
> configuration/pluginXY/constants.txt
> configuration/pluginXY/...

But these must be included by the user
and so I think would be the right place for
optional TS, but not for the minimum-TS
absolutely needed by a plugin ...

> Where pluginXY is a descriptive name of the plugin like searchForm,
> detailsView, ....
> 
> ext_typoscript_setup.txt and ext_typoscript_constants.txt are as polluting
> as DEFAULT_CSS in TS.

DEFAULT_CSS I don't like either in TS  ;)


> Regards 
> Elmar

-
Regars,
   Stefan




More information about the TYPO3-dev mailing list